Evanescence "Fallen" (20th Anniversary) 2024-09-20 A Sailor's Guide To Earth20th anniversary deluxe edition of Evanescences 2003 debut, Fallen. Featuring the stratospheric hit singles "Bring Me To Life," "Going Under," "Everybody's Fool" and "My Immortal." Since it's release, Fallen has become one of the worlds best selling albums of all time, with more than 17 million copies sold worldwide. This remastered and expanded edition includes B sides, rarities, and more.
